ISLAMABAD: Leader of Opposition in the National Assembly, Syed Khursheed Ahmed Shah, has said that after the formal request of National Accountability Bureau (NAB), the Interior Ministry should place the names of former Prime Minister Nawaz Sharif, his daughter Maryam Nawaz and son-in-law Captain Muhammad Safdar (retd) on the Exit Control List (ECL).

He expressed these views while talking to media persons here at his chamber in the Parliament House on Wednesday.

The law and rules in the country should be the same for everyone. The NAB formally requested the Ministry of Interior to place the names of Nawaz Sharif and his family on the ECL. There is no reference against Sharjeel Memon but still he presented himself before the court. Others have had references presented against them but they are free to roam around, the opposition leader added.

Shah further said that rules and regulations should be the same for those caught in similar cases.

“If now they are being treated like everyone else, let it be,” he added, while indirectly referring to Nawaz Sharif and his family.

When asked if Sharif family members should be added to the ECL, Shah said if the accountability body has asked for it, the Interior Ministry will have to act on it. If they do not act then they should free Memon and remove his name from the ECL.

The NAB dispatched two letters to the ministry, one, asking for the name of Nawaz Sharif to be placed on the ECL, citing him being an accused in the Azizia Mills reference, Flagship reference and Avenfield properties reference.

In the second letter, it requested to place names of Maryam Nawaz and Safdar on the ECL as both are accused in the Avenfield properties reference.
